Driving at a High Rate of Speed, Owner Lost Control And Struck Two Trees,...

Driving at a high rate of speed, owner lost control and struck two trees, splitting the car in half and causing the front half to catch fire. The accident occured at 3:30 in the morning and the driver was killed.

2010 BMW M-Series M3 E90. Happened in Palm Beach, Florida, USA.
